how to get cash with out a physical card in japan
Japan has 47 prefectures, and withdrawing cash without a physical card is possible in many areas, primarily through contactless methods like mobile apps (Apple Pay, Google Pay) linked to digital wallets or bank accounts. Cardless ATMs, often using NFC or QR codes, are available but not universal, with major banks and convenience stores like 7-Eleven and Lawson offering the most reliable options. Contactless debit card payments are increasingly accepted, especially in urban areas, but cash remains dominant in rural regions. ATM availability and hours vary, with 24/7 access common at convenience stores but limited at some bank ATMs.
